Surgery for syringomyelia in India typically costs from $4,800 to $8,200. The final price depends on the specific surgical technique, hospital tier, and the city. In the US, similar procedures cost around $100,000 on average. India offers savings of around 94%. Surgical fees generally include the procedure, neurosurgeon fees, basic diagnostic imaging, and standard hospital stay.

Healthcare in India is based on cost-effective models. Most of the hospitals are private — 65% of annual GDP is out-of-pocket medical payments.
1.4 mln doctors provide excellent treatments in the country. 74% of the Indian medical care is private. The local healthcare centers have international and national certificates that confirm the high quality of services and patients' safety:
India has 39 JCI-accredited medical centers in contrast with 20 JCI-certified facilities in Germany and 10 hospitals in Israel.
